#dc596e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c596e is composed of 86.3% red, 34.9%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.5% magenta, 50%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 350.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 60.6%. #dc596e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2dc with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#dc596e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dc596e has RGB values of R:220, G:89,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.5,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14440814.

Shades and Tints of #dc596e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0304 is the darkest color, while #fefbfc is the lightest one.
